Essential Elements of an SEO Invoice
  • Business Information: Your name/agency, address, phone, email, and website.
  • Client Details: Client company, billing contact, website being optimized.
  • Invoice Details: Invoice number, date issued, service period, and due date.
  • Service Description: Clear description of SEO services provided this period.
  • Deliverables: Specific deliverables: pages optimized, content created, links built.
  • Hours (if applicable): For hourly billing, show time spent by category.
  • Tool Costs: If passing through tool costs, itemize each tool and cost.
  • Content Costs: If content is separate, show content pieces and costs.
  • Link Building: Number of links acquired and associated costs.
  • Performance Summary: Optional: Key metrics—rankings, traffic, conversions.
  • Subtotal, Taxes, Total: Clear breakdown of all services and amounts.
  • Payment Terms: Due date, accepted methods, and late payment policy.
SEO Invoicing Best Practices
  • Use Monthly Retainers: SEO is ongoing work. Monthly retainers provide stability for both parties.
  • Include Performance Metrics: Show ranking improvements, traffic growth, and conversions. Demonstrates value.
  • Itemize Major Categories: Break down by: technical SEO, content, link building, reporting.
  • Invoice at Start of Month: For retainers, invoice before the service period begins.
  • Document Deliverables: List specific work completed: pages optimized, content published, links acquired.
  • Separate Content Costs: If content creation is extra, itemize it clearly.
  • Track Link Building: Document links acquired with domain authority metrics.
  • Include Tool Reports: Attach or reference your SEO tool reports (Ahrefs, SEMrush, etc.).
  • Set Realistic Expectations: Include notes about SEO timelines—it takes months to see results.
  • Provide Monthly Reports: Attach detailed monthly reports showing work done and results achieved.
SEO Services Pricing Guide

SEO pricing varies by service type, scope, and market:

Monthly Retainers:

  • Small business/local SEO: $500-$1,500/month
  • Mid-market SEO: $1,500-$5,000/month
  • Enterprise SEO: $5,000-$20,000+/month
  • E-commerce SEO: $2,000-$10,000/month

Project-Based:

  • SEO audit (small site): $500-$1,500
  • SEO audit (medium site): $1,500-$5,000
  • SEO audit (enterprise): $5,000-$25,000
  • Keyword research: $500-$2,000
  • Technical SEO fix: $1,000-$5,000
  • Site migration: $2,500-$15,000

Content & Links:

  • SEO blog post: $200-$800
  • Pillar content: $500-$2,000
  • Link building: $100-$500 per link
  • Guest post placement: $150-$1,000

Hourly Consulting:

  • Junior SEO: $75-$100/hour
  • Senior SEO: $150-$250/hour
  • SEO strategist: $200-$400/hour
Standard Payment Terms for SEO Services

Recommended payment terms for SEO work:

For Monthly Retainers:

  • Invoice at start of each month
  • Payment due before work begins
  • Net 7-15 typical
  • Auto-pay preferred for ongoing work

For Audits/Projects:

  • 50% deposit before starting
  • 50% upon delivery
  • Or 100% upfront for smaller audits

For Content:

  • Payment before publication
  • Or included in monthly retainer

For Link Building:

  • Payment before outreach begins
  • No guarantees on specific placements

Tool Costs:

  • Pass-through monthly
  • Or built into retainer
  • Billed at cost or with markup

Late Payment:

  • Grace period: 5-7 days
  • Late fee: 1.5% per month
  • Work pauses at 15+ days overdue
  • Reports and access suspended if seriously late
Common SEO Invoicing Mistakes to Avoid
  • No Performance Documentation: Always show metrics. Clients need to see value for their investment.
  • Vague Service Descriptions: Detail what you actually did: pages optimized, content created, links built.
  • Invoicing After Work: For retainers, invoice at start of month. Don't work without payment secured.
  • Not Tracking Deliverables: Keep detailed records of all work completed each month.
  • Mixing Strategy and Execution: If strategy is separate from execution, itemize them clearly.
  • Unclear Tool Billing: Be transparent about tool costs—built in or passed through.
  • No Contract Reference: Reference your agreement. Connects invoice to approved scope and terms.
  • Overpromising Results: Don't guarantee rankings. Focus on work deliverables and best efforts.
  • Poor Scope Management: When clients ask for extra work, document and bill it separately.
  • Weak Follow-Up: Follow up on late payments. SEO clients often have AP delays.
